Foundational SEO Strategies for Real Estate Websites

Driving more site traffic starts with implementing proven SEO strategies designed for the real estate niche. Applying a blend of research, technical improvements, and content enhancements allows your real estate website to build trust and authority with clients and search engines.

Conducting Real Estate Keyword Research

Effective keyword research forms the base of every strong SEO strategy. Begin by identifying high-intent, location-based keywords that match your property markets, such as “homes for sale in Dallas” or “Miami luxury condos.”

Leverage t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, and SEMrush to analyze search volume, keyword difficulty, and long-tail keyword opportunities more relevant to your specific neighborhoods or property types. Long-tail keywords attract qualified traffic by targeting more specific searches, such as “pet-friendly apartments in Austin with parking.”

Organize keywords into categories for primary pages, property listings, and blog topics. This allows you to build a clear structure, improve relevance, and connect your content directly to user search intent. Regularly review and update your keyword list to align with market trends and competitor activity.

On-Page Optimization for Property Listings

On-page optimization ensures each property listing is easy for both users and search engines to understand. Every listing needs a unique, descriptive title tag including primary keywords and location, such as “3 Bedroom House for Sale in Denver.”

Meta descriptions should concisely summarize the main features and value of each property, helping increase click-through rates from search results. Use header tags (H1, H2, etc.) to break up listing information and include additional relevant keywords where appropriate.

Keep URLs short, descriptive, and keyword-focused, for example, /homes/miami-beach/oceanfront-condo. Present high-quality content with detailed property information, images, and features to build authority and credibility in your niche. Use tables or bullet points to highlight specifications, room sizes, or amenities clearly.

Enhancing User Experience and Mobile Optimization

User experience is a significant ranking factor, especially for real estate websites with large inventories. Focus on fast load times, intuitive navigation, and a clutter-free layout, enabling visitors to explore listings without frustration.

A responsive design ensures your site adapts smoothly to different devices and screen sizes, making it mobile-friendly for people browsing on smartphones and tablets. Mobile-optimized websites tend to rank higher and retain users longer, as buyers frequently search for properties while on the go.

Prioritize clear call-to-action buttons, visible contact options, and logical menu structures that guide users through your listings and resources. Use optimized images and streamlined code to further boost load speed and overall performance.

Utilizing Schema Markup and Structured Data

Integrating schema markup on your real estate website can increase visibility in search engine results pages by making your listings eligible for rich snippets. Use structured data formats like JSON-LD to provide details such as location, property type, price, number of bedrooms, and agent contact information.

Display star ratings, open house dates, or listing availability directly in search results to enhance credibility and draw more clicks. Schema markup signals trust and helps Google accurately index your content, which benefits both your site’s authority and search performance.

Regularly test your structured data using Google’s Rich Results Test tool to ensure proper implementation and address any errors promptly. By standardizing property information, you help search engines deliver more relevant results to prospective buyers and renters. Advanced Techniques to Boost Local Search Visibility

A team of professionals working together in an office with laptops and digital devices showing charts and maps related to real estate marketing.

Maximizing local search visibility for your real estate website requires a combination of precise local SEO efforts, outreach, content that connects with your audience, and leveraging analytics to make data-driven decisions. Implementing and optimizing these key strategies will position your site for better rankings and targeted traffic.

Local SEO and Google My Business Optimization

Optimizing your presence on Google My Business is essential. Ensure your N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) is accurate and identical across all profiles and directories. Upload high-quality images of your office and showcase client testimonials to build trust with local buyers and sellers.

Encourage clients to leave reviews and respond to them promptly. Choose the most relevant business categories, add detailed service descriptions, and use targeted local keywords within your profile. Update your business hours, post regular updates, and take advantage of Google Posts. Apply these local SEO techniques to appear more prominently in local map packs and search results.

Strategic Link Building and Backlinks

Earning and maintaining high-quality backlinks boosts your website’s authority in the eyes of search engines. Focus on building relationships with local organizations, housing community forums, local news sites, and chambers of commerce.

Reach out to local bloggers or neighborhood associations for features or interviews. If you work with unique properties—such as luxury homes in Miami—showcase them on niche platforms for additional targeted backlinks. Leverage digital PR by submitting your market reports or market updates to industry publications. Diverse backlink profiles, from local and national resources, support long-term SEO growth.

Content Marketing and Neighborhood Guides

Publishing detailed, well-structured neighborhood guides is one of the most effective real estate SEO tips. Highlight local amenities, schools, market trends, and community events. Use tables and bullet lists to compare features, prices, or local attractions.

Include market reports and timely market updates for your service areas. Address common questions clients might have about moving to or living in a specific neighborhood. Such targeted content naturally attracts both search engines and users—driving cost-effective marketing and higher levels of engagement. Regularly update these guides to maintain online visibility and relevance.

Leveraging Analytics and Social Media Integration

Track the performance of your SEO services and campaigns with Google Analytics and Google Search Console. Monitor website traffic, bounce rates, conversions, and which pages receive the most targeted traffic. These insights will help you refine your strategies to better attract and retain clients.

Integrate your real estate website with key social media platforms. Share market trends, success stories, and featured listings to increase reach and engagement. Social media activity can help drive referral visits and provide indirect SEO benefits through increased brand exposure and local authority. Analyze engagement data to optimize content distribution and audience targeting.

What key tactics can improve my real estate website’s search engine ranking?

Publishing neighborhood guides, optimizing property listings with descriptive metadata, and ensuring your site loads quickly are all essential. Use schema markup to enhance property details for search engines. Aim to secure backlinks from local news or industry-specific sites to build authority and trust.

How can I optimize local SEO for my real estate business?

Claim and update your Google Business Profile with accurate contact details and business hours. Add your business location to your website’s footer and include local keywords in headings and content. Gathering reviews from clients and building citations on reputable real estate directories will also help you rank higher locally.

What are the best SEO tools for analyzing real estate website performance?

Google Search Console and Google Analytics track traffic, user behavior, and technical issues. SEMrush and Ahrefs provide detailed keyword rankings, competitor analysis, and backlink insights. Screaming Frog helps detect site errors, broken links, and duplicate content that could impact your site’s performance.

What role do keywords play in real estate website SEO?

Keywords connect your listings and other content with what buyers and sellers are searching for. Focus on long-tail keywords like “homes for sale in [city]” or “[neighborhood] real estate agent” to match user queries. How to track and measure the success of my real estate SEO efforts?

Monitor keyword rankings, organic traffic, user engagement, and conversion rates using analytics tools. Set up goals in Google Analytics to track actions such as form submissions or contact requests. Regularly review these metrics to identify what’s working and adjust your SEO strategy as needed for better results.
